Damascus Document
Sons of Zadok; migration to Damascus; the New Covenant
1The priests are the penitents of Israel who went forth out of the land of Judah: and (the
2Levites are) they who joined them. And the sons of Zadok are the elect of Israel called by 3 the name, that are holding office in the end of the days. Behold the statement of their names according to their generations, and the period of their office, and the number of their afflictions, and the years of their sojournings, and the statement of their works.
4The first saints whom God pardoned, Both justified the righteous, And condemned the wicked.
5And all they who come after them must do according to the interpretation of the Law, In which the forefathers were instructed Until the consummation of the period of these years.
6In accordance with the covenant which God established with the forefathers built them a sure house .(
7In order to pardon their sins, So shall God make atonement for them. And on the consummation of the period [of the number] of these years They shall no more join themselves to the house of Judah. ~ But shall every one stand up against his net. The wall shall have been built, The boundary been far removed. 6. In order to pardon, &c.
